When what was supposed to be a fun date night opens Pandora's Box, Nia is left feeling betrayed. In this suspenseful and romantic series from Nako, love has been put to the ultimate test. Can the past be forgiven?
Nia Hudson, fashion powerhouse and philanthropist, swore that love wasn't for her because she was too busy chasing after her dreams. The quiet girl from Brooklyn refused to go back to the projects. Being raised by her selfish aunt was the push she needed to run far away and never return. But when a blast from the past resurfaces and refuses to take "no" for an answer, Nia decides to give him one hour of her time. Surprisingly, one hour turns into a week, a week transpires into months, and before she knows it, the two have become a couple.
Together, East and Nia don't paint the perfect picture. They have nothing in common, and in fact, he's the complete opposite of everything she stands for. Dangerous, thrilling, edgy, and secretive describe her current beau. East is definitely living life in the fast lane, selling everything he can get his hands on, and not knowing when the Feds--or friends disguised as enemies--might come after him.

Nakoreya "Nako" Roberson is a native of Atlanta, Georgia studying mass communications, political science, and Spanish at Jackson State University. She signed her first publishing deal in December 2014, and her first release, The Connect's Wife, ranked number one in the following Amazon categories: African American Romance, Urban Fiction, and African American Fiction. At twenty-two, Nako has already made her mark on the literary world. Her ultimate goal is to assist other authors in realizing their true potential and change the world one novel at a time.
